Transaction f9321afb768c3a7ce7a8c5c5e39495ae707b6f558cb9e5dabab8909873f0f7fa

1 Input
2 Outputs
  • f9321afb768c3a7ce7a8c5c5e39495ae707b6f558cb9e5dabab8909873f0f7fa:0
  • value  22040000
    address  3LF7LaxHgqzoSi8uPmDf72A5juYNHtmHMz
  • f9321afb768c3a7ce7a8c5c5e39495ae707b6f558cb9e5dabab8909873f0f7fa:1
  • value  3327468249
    address  31xhZAKW6iC4KLbqi71sxio5LXwk2vgy9d